Original abstract
Reoxidation of steel is a term for summary designation of secondary and tertiary oxidation of steel occurring during keeping the metal in a ladle after tapping it from a furnace and during casting in a mould cavity. During reoxidation the oxygen concentration and its activity in a casting are growing. In case that oxygen activity exceeds the equilibrium activity of oxygen with carbon the casting part or the whole casting can be afflicted with gas cavities of carbon monoxide. With higher oxygen activity the formations of oxides of elements with lower deoxidation ability (Mn, Si) continues. Those oxides can form in castings the extensive slaggy formations in their volume or on the casting surface designated as secondary slag inclusions. Thus the steel reoxidation directly influences surface and internal quality of steel castings and consequently the manufacturing costs too.
